The house next door is a rental and has been vacant for a few months. Now it's gettin cold and the heat is turned off over there so i'm assuming all the mice are migrating to my place. Never had them before so I figure they must be coming from there. I got glue boards all over the place and caught 8 in the last 2 days. I'm hopin I'm at least breaking even. How and the hell do you get rid of these things. Livin in the country it was always just an excepted part of the deal to catch a few at the begining of each winter but I'm in town right now and aint gonna tolerate it in here. How do you get rid of these things. I been all around the foundation and can't find anyplace obvious where they are comin in at.

Mouse traps always worked good for me stick some bologna on it and make sure ya tie it to something just in case ya get a runner we lost a few traps that way.

They could have got in from the roof or where your electric lines come into the house.
